Abstract

1420337 Defrosting AMF Inc 18 Oct 1973 [15 Dec 1972] 58141/72 Heading F4H A defrosting control device comprises an ice sensing device including a series of elements on which frost is to accumulate and which are moved towards each other periodically. When a predetermined amount of ice has formed on the elements, this movement is restricted and causes actuation of a defrost control switch. As shown, a switch-actuating lever 16 is supported on rods 11, 20 and is engaged by a spring 22, a weak, frost-collecting spring 18 and a cam 24 driven by a motor 25. If no defrosting is necessary, on rotation of the cam, the spring 18 collapses and the lever 16 pivots, using the spring 22 as a fulcrum. If frost builds up on the spring 18 to a predetermined thickness, the spring compresses the frost into solid ice and will not collapse, whereupon the cam 24 causes the lever to compress the spring 22 and the lower end of the lever moves a pivoted' arm 26 to actuate a switch 36 controlling the compressor, fan and heater of a refrigerating chamber. The arm 26 is locked in the switch actuating position by a pivoted lever 27 connected to the arm 26 by a spring 32. The lever 27 is released from its locking position by movement of the lever 16 when the frost is removed from the spring 18. In a second embodiment, Fig. 2 (not shown), two members are mounted for linear axial movement on a rod and have interengaging cam faces. The members are urged towards each other by a strong spring and a weak, frostcollecting, spring. One of the members is rotated and, when the frost-collecting spring is coated with ice, is moved axially against the action of the strong spring by relative rotation of the cam faces to actuate the defrost switch. A time-delay may be incorporated to delay switching-on of the fan for a period after the compressor is re-started. The coil spring for frost-collecting may be replaced by discs separated by resilient pads.
